#5f9451 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5f9451 is composed of 37.3% red, 58%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.3%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 107.5 degrees, a saturation of 29.3% and a lightness of 44.9%. #5f9451 color hex could be obtained by blending #beffa2 with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#5f9451
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050905 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5f9451
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7a6b is the less saturated color, while #31e302 is the most saturated one.
